The Boston Celtics will look a lot different in 2025-26. And while all the key roster departures have been understandably branded in a negative light, not enough attention has been paid to the opportunities created for some of Boston’s up-and-coming players.

Beyond guys like Jordan Walsh or Hugo González potentially seeing minutes that would be unavailable if the Celtics were fully loaded, there will be chances for established or fringe rotation guys to take a leap. Payton Pritchard certainly has a chance to up his production. So, too, does 26-year-old center Neemias Queta, especially given the state of Boston’s frontcourt.
